
Scents have a profound and multifaceted impact on the human body, influencing both physical and emotional well-being through the intricate connection between the olfactory system and the brain. When inhaled, odor molecules stimulate the olfactory receptors in the nose, which send signals to the brain’s limbic system, often referred to as the emotional brain. This direct pathway explains why certain scents can evoke vivid memories, alter mood, or even trigger physiological responses such as changes in heart rate, blood pressure, and stress levels. For instance, lavender is known to promote relaxation and improve sleep, while peppermint can enhance focus and energy. Beyond emotional effects, scents can also affect the body’s hormonal balance, immune response, and even digestion, as seen in aromatherapy practices. Understanding how scents interact with the body highlights their potential as a powerful tool for enhancing health, mood, and overall quality of life.

Olfactory System and Brain Connection: Scents trigger brain responses, influencing emotions, memories, and cognitive functions
The olfactory system, our sense of smell, is a direct pathway to the brain, bypassing the thalamus—the brain's relay station for sensory information. This unique connection allows scents to trigger immediate and powerful responses, influencing emotions, memories, and cognitive functions. Unlike other senses, smell has an unparalleled ability to evoke vivid recollections, such as the aroma of freshly baked cookies transporting you back to childhood. This phenomenon occurs because the olfactory bulb is closely linked to the brain’s limbic system, which governs emotions and memory. For instance, the scent of lavender has been shown to reduce anxiety by lowering cortisol levels, while peppermint can enhance focus and alertness. Understanding this connection opens doors to using scents strategically for mental and emotional well-being.

Descriptively, the process of scent-induced brain responses is both intricate and fascinating. When you inhale a scent, odor molecules bind to receptors in the nasal cavity, sending signals to the olfactory bulb. From there, information travels to the amygdala and hippocampus, regions tied to emotion and memory. This rapid transmission explains why a whiff of a familiar scent can instantly evoke a mood or recollection. For instance, the smell of freshly cut grass might trigger feelings of calmness associated with outdoor activities. By understanding this mechanism, we can curate scent environments to support mental health, enhance learning, or even alleviate stress in high-pressure situations.

Impact on Mood and Stress: Aromas like lavender reduce stress, while citrus scents boost mood and energy
Scents have a profound, often immediate impact on our emotional state, acting as a direct line to the brain’s limbic system—the seat of emotions and memories. Among the most studied are lavender and citrus aromas, which exemplify how specific fragrances can either calm or invigorate. Lavender, with its floral, herbal notes, has been clinically shown to reduce cortisol levels, the body’s primary stress hormone. A 2013 study in the *International Journal of Nursing Practice* found that participants who inhaled lavender oil for 15 minutes twice daily reported significantly lower stress levels compared to a control group. Conversely, citrus scents like orange and lemon contain limonene, a compound that stimulates dopamine production, fostering a sense of alertness and positivity. This duality highlights how aromas can be tailored to address specific emotional needs.
To harness lavender’s stress-reducing benefits, consider incorporating it into your evening routine. Add 3–5 drops of lavender essential oil to a diffuser 30 minutes before bedtime, or dilute 2 drops in a carrier oil and apply to pulse points. For children over 6, a single drop diluted in a teaspoon of coconut oil can be massaged onto the soles of their feet to promote relaxation without overwhelming their sensitive systems. Avoid using undiluted essential oils directly on the skin, as they can cause irritation. For those seeking a quick stress remedy, inhaling lavender directly from the bottle for 1–2 minutes can provide immediate relief.
Citrus scents, on the other hand, are ideal for morning or midday use when energy levels dip. Start your day by diffusing 4–6 drops of wild orange or grapefruit essential oil in your workspace to enhance focus and mood. For a portable solution, add 10 drops of citrus oil to a 10ml roller bottle filled with fractionated coconut oil and apply to wrists or temples as needed. Studies, such as one published in *Psychological Science*, have shown that citrus aromas can improve cognitive performance by up to 15% in tasks requiring sustained attention. However, avoid using citrus oils before bedtime, as their energizing effects may interfere with sleep.

Appetite and Digestion Effects: Smells like peppermint can suppress appetite, while others stimulate hunger signals
The human olfactory system is a powerful gateway to the brain, influencing not only our emotions and memories but also our physical responses, including appetite and digestion. Certain scents, like peppermint, have been shown to act as natural appetite suppressants. When inhaled, peppermint oil can trigger a feeling of fullness, reducing the urge to eat. This effect is attributed to its active compound, menthol, which interacts with receptors in the nose and mouth, signaling the brain to curb hunger. Studies suggest that simply sniffing peppermint essential oil for 5–10 minutes can decrease cravings, making it a useful tool for those aiming to manage their calorie intake.
Conversely, other scents can stimulate hunger signals, often by triggering the brain’s reward system or evoking memories of food. The aroma of baking bread, for instance, activates the limbic system, which is closely tied to emotions and appetite. This phenomenon is often exploited in grocery stores, where the smell of fresh pastries or rotisserie chicken is strategically wafted through the air to encourage impulse buying and consumption. Similarly, the scent of vanilla has been found to increase feelings of satisfaction and reduce sugar cravings, making it a dual-edged tool for both suppressing and stimulating appetite depending on the context.
Practical application of these scent effects can be integrated into daily routines. For those looking to reduce snacking, placing a diffuser with peppermint oil in the kitchen or carrying a peppermint-scented inhaler can serve as a mindful reminder to pause before eating. On the flip side, individuals struggling with poor appetite, such as the elderly or those recovering from illness, might benefit from exposure to food-related scents like cinnamon or garlic during mealtimes. However, it’s crucial to use essential oils sparingly—a few drops are sufficient, as overexposure can lead to desensitization or irritation.
The interplay between scent and digestion extends beyond appetite. Aromas like ginger and fennel have been traditionally used to alleviate digestive discomfort. Ginger, in particular, contains compounds that can reduce nausea and promote gastric emptying, making it a valuable scent for those with indigestion. Incorporating these scents through teas, diffusers, or topical applications can complement dietary changes for better digestive health. For example, inhaling ginger essential oil for 2–3 minutes after a heavy meal may provide quick relief from bloating.

Immune System Response: Essential oils like eucalyptus may enhance immunity by reducing inflammation and fighting pathogens
The human body's immune system is a complex network, and its response to external stimuli, such as scents, is a fascinating area of study. Essential oils, particularly eucalyptus, have been under the spotlight for their potential immune-boosting properties. But how exactly can a simple aroma influence our body's defense mechanism?
The Power of Inhalation: A Direct Route to Immunity
Inhaling essential oils is like taking a shortcut to the immune system. When you breathe in the crisp, refreshing scent of eucalyptus, the volatile compounds travel through your nasal passages and interact with the olfactory system, which is directly linked to the brain. This stimulation can trigger a cascade of responses, including the release of neurotransmitters and hormones that influence immune function. For instance, research suggests that eucalyptus oil may increase the activity of white blood cells, our body's first line of defense against pathogens.
Fighting Inflammation, One Breath at a Time
Chronic inflammation is often an underlying issue in many health conditions, and managing it is crucial for overall well-being. Here's where eucalyptus oil steps in as a potential natural remedy. Its anti-inflammatory properties are attributed to the presence of a compound called eucalyptol. When inhaled, this compound may help reduce inflammation in the respiratory system, providing relief from conditions like asthma and bronchitis. A study published in the *Journal of Immunology Research* found that eucalyptol could suppress inflammatory responses in the airways, offering a promising approach to managing respiratory inflammation.
